When you are searching for a Yorkshire Terrier puppy, make sure that the breeder has a microchip. This will ensure that in the event that the puppy gets lost, it is returned to the owner. This helps pet owners keep an eye on their puppy's medical history. The puppy will need regular medical attention, particularly for its teeth and ears.
Yorkies are susceptible to joint problems and dental issues, so good oral hygiene is essential for yorkies. This means brushing your dog's teeth every day and having a professional cleaning with a veterinarian at least once a year. It is also crucial to trim a Yorkie's nails and keep the hair tidy. Ear cleanings and ear checks are needed every week to prevent infections.

Yorkies are small dogs with a big personality. They love to play with their owners and snuggle up. They are intelligent and can learn quickly with an organized, consistent training. However they can be a bit stubborn and require a person who can be their pack leader and set limits early. They also do not do well when left to themselves for extended durations of time.
Yorkshire Terriers are suspicious of strangers by nature and will bark if they feel threatened. However they can be trained to not bark when there are people or other pets around. This is one of the main reasons why socializing puppies from an early age is crucial. If they're well-socialized, they'll be able to get along with other pets and children in the home. They might still possess the natural urge to chase smaller animals, so it is important to keep them on a leash.
